1. Understanding Nutritional Needs
During an anabolic steroid cycle, the body’s metabolism can change significantly. It is essential to adjust caloric intake and macronutrient distribution for optimal results. Key nutritional elements include:
- Protein: Essential for muscle repair and growth. High-quality protein sources like chicken, fish, eggs, and legumes should be prioritized.
- Carbohydrates: Vital for fueling workouts and replenishing glycogen stores. Complex carbohydrates like brown rice, oats, and sweet potatoes are excellent options.
- Fats: Healthy fats are crucial for hormonal balance and overall health. Sources such as avocados, nuts, and olive oil should be included in the diet.
2. Micronutrients and Supplements
In addition to macronutrients, micronutrients play a significant role in recovery and performance. Vitamins and minerals help with immune function and energy metabolism.
- Vitamin D: Supports bone health and immune function.
- Magnesium: Aids in muscle function and recovery.
- Omega-3 Fatty Acids: Helps reduce inflammation and support cardiovascular health.
3. Hydration
Staying hydrated during a steroid cycle is crucial. Anabolic steroids can increase water retention and impact electrolyte balance. Adequate hydration supports optimal performance and recovery.
4. Timing and Planning
Meal timing can enhance the effects of an anabolic steroid cycle. Consider implementing the following strategies:
- Pre-Workout Meals: Consume a balanced meal rich in protein and carbohydrates to fuel your workout.
- Post-Workout Nutrition: Prioritize a meal or shake with protein and simple carbohydrates within 30 minutes after training to aid recovery.
